https://www.Heart-Valve-Surgery.com - When a child is diagnosed with severe aortic regurgitation or aortic stenosis, parents are faced with an important decision: What is the best long-term treatment option? One potential solution for pediatric patients is the Ross Procedure, which replaces the diseased aortic valve with the child’s own pulmonary valve. Unlike mechanical or pig valves, the pulmonary autograft can grow with the child, reducing the need for multiple surgeries over time. To provide expert insights on this topic, we spoke with Dr. Vaughn Starnes, Surgeon-in-Chief at Keck Medicine of USC in Los Angeles, California, and a leading expert in pediatric cardiac surgery. Dr. Starnes has been performing the Ross procedure in children since the early 1990s and shares his extensive knowledge on the benefits of this approach. Dr. Starnes has performed over 650 Ross operations.
